Pick-your-own is available at High Hill Orchard during the harvest window. Guests walk the rows, pick straight from the tree, and settle up at the farm stand.
Apple season at High Hill Orchard tracks the rest of Connecticut. Most fruit ripens between late August and late October. The window most families aim for is the last two weeks of September into the first two of October, that's when Honeycrisp, Empire, and mid-season varieties usually overlap.
Weekend mornings between 9 a.m. and noon are the friendliest arrival window. If you can swing a weekday, Tuesday or Wednesday mornings are the quietest, some visitors report having entire rows to themselves.
